Lean-to conservatories not just improve the aesthetic appeal of a residential or commercial property however likewise use numerous practical advantages.
Natural Light: The main advantage of a lean-to conservatory roofing is the abundance of natural light it provides. This can make areas feel larger and more welcoming.
Energy Efficiency: Modern roofing products, such as double or triple glazing, can enhance energy effectiveness. They help maintain heat in the winter and keep the area cooler in the summer season.
Cost: Lean-to conservatories are typically more affordable than their Victorian or Edwardian equivalents due to their uncomplicated design and construction.
Adaptability: These conservatories can serve numerous functions. Whether you desire a brilliant office, a peaceful reading nook, or a household event area, a lean-to conservatory can adapt to your requirements.
Low Maintenance: Depending on the products utilized, the maintenance of lean-to conservatories can be very little, specifically when compared to conventional extensions.

When selecting the roofing material for a lean-to conservatory, numerous elements need to be thought about:
Aesthetic Appeal: Homeowners need to pick a roofing system that matches their existing home design. Glass roofings are fantastic for modern homes, while tiled roofing systems are much better matched for standard designs.
Spending plan: Understanding the spending plan for the task will assist narrow down material choices. Polycarbonate is normally the most inexpensive choice, while glass and tiled roofings can be on the higher end.
Energy Efficiency: Depending on the meant use of the conservatory, energy-efficient alternatives like thermal glass or solid roofing systems need to be thought about to handle heating & cooling expenses.
Weight Considerations: The weight of the roofing material can affect the structural integrity of the lean-to conservatory, especially when connected to an existing wall.

To keep a lean-to conservatory looking pristine and functioning successfully, routine upkeep is important. Below are some quick tips:
Regular Cleaning: Keeping the roof tidy prevents dirt and algae build-up, guaranteeing maximum light penetration. Make use of a ladder and a soft-bristle brush or work with a professional cleaner if the roofing is too high.
Inspect Seals and Joints: Periodically examine seals and joints for any wear or damage, particularly around potential issue areas like the edges where the roofing system fulfills the wall.
Gutter Maintenance: Ensure that rain gutters are devoid of debris to avoid water damage or leaks, and examine them regularly, specifically after heavy rains.
Structural Inspection: Carry out annual assessments for any indications of damage, warping, or expansion, especially if the roof product has actually been affected by snow or heavy rains.
